just as an information:
i could remedy my mistake (not updating to the correct version before flashing with linux) by getting some inspiration from the previous build and install instructions (https://sailfishos.org/wiki/Sailfish...y_period.21.29) - i edited the flash script, commenting the part with oem flash: sed -i 's/echo "Flashing oem partition.."/echo "oem partition is populated manually through recovery"/' flash.sh- then copied the *loire.img files by hand to the appropriate partition: - flashed the phone with the sony blobs:- afterwards rebooted the phone into fastboot mode againfastboot flash system *_loire.img- did a boot into recovery image:sudo fastboot boot hybris-recovery.img- telneted into the phone in the rescue boot. - and flashed again with the modified flash.sh - and that worked. my phone now boots into sailfish x. too late to check functions now. that'll teach me (again) to better respect instructions before doing stuff. thanks for the hints! :) |
